دوره آموزشی برنامه نویسی برای مبتدیان : iOS 15 و Swift 5
2 ساعت 32 دقیقهمبتدی2022-01-24
مدرسین

Todd Perkins
Developer specializing in iOS
جزئیات دوره
آیا می خواهید برنامه های بومی iOS را توسعه دهید، اما مطمئن نیستید از کجا شروع کنید؟ این دوره به شما فرصتی می دهد تا آن را با یک برنامه ساده iOS که می توانید در یک روز ایجاد کنید، امتحان کنید. مربی تاد پرکینز از نمایش های بصری جنبه های مفهومی کدنویسی استفاده می کند تا محتوا را مرتبط و قابل هضم کند. تاد به شما نشان میدهد که چگونه محیط کدنویسی خود را تنظیم کنید، با متغیرها کار کنید، روشها و عبارات شرطی را درک کنید و از آنها استفاده کنید و موارد دیگر. به علاوه، او بهترین شیوه ها را برای تکمیل درخواست شما بررسی می کند. در پایان دوره، شما مهارت ایجاد یک برنامه ساده iOS را به تنهایی خواهید داشت.
مهارت ها
SwiftiOS DevelopmentiOSMobile DevelopmentAppleDeep Dive (X:Y)
سرفصل ها
0. مقدمه
- 01 - یک اپلیکیشن ساده در یک روز بسازید
- 02 - آنچه باید بدانید
- 03 - برنامه تمام شده
1. تنظیم محیط کدنویسی
- 04 - یافتن و نصب Xcode
- 05 - ایجاد یک پروژه Xcode
- 06 - درک رابط Xcode
- 07 - پیکربندی Xcode برای توسعه برنامه
- 08 - پیکربندی شبیه ساز iOS برای توسعه برنامه
2. برنامه نویسی بلوک های ساختمان - متغیرها
- 09 - برنامه نویسی چگونه کار می کند
- 10 - درک متغیرها و ثابت ها
- 11 - کار با متغیرها در زمین بازی
- 12 - استفاده از متغیرها در SwiftUI
- 13 - پشته ها و ویژگی های SwiftUI
- 14 - ایجاد یک جزء SwiftUI سفارشی
- 15 - ایجاد دکمه های ماشین حساب
- 16 - افزودن ویژگی های قابل تنظیم پویا
- 17 - چالش - اتمام دکمه های ماشین حساب
- 18 - راه حل - اتمام دکمه های ماشین حساب
3. برنامه نویسی بلوک های ساختمانی - روش ها
- 19 - شناخت روشها
- 20 - استفاده از روش ها
- 21 - اجرای کد با فشردن یک دکمه
- 22 - استفاده از متد به عنوان متغیر
- 23 - انتقال پارامترها به متغیرهای متد
- 24 - اتصال SwiftUI
- 25 - استفاده از روش های مختلف برای رسیدگی به رویدادهای مختلف
- 26 - چالش - ایجاد روش برای دکمه های دیگر
- 27 - راه حل - ایجاد روش برای دکمه های دیگر
4. برنامه نویسی بلوک های ساختمان - جریان کنترل
- 28 - درک عبارات شرطی
- 29 - استفاده از دستورات شرطی و بولی
- 30 - فشار دادن دکمه های عددی
- 31 - دستورات اختیاری و if let
- 32 - شمارش
- 33 - چالش - شرایط
- 34 - حل - شروط
5. تکمیل برنامه
- 35 - ذخیره شماره ذخیره شده
- 36 - نمایش مجموع با زدن دکمه تساوی
- 37 - قالب بندی عدد با کاما
- 38 - اضافه کردن نماد برنامه
- 39 - چالش - دکمه پاک کردن
- 40 - راه حل - دکمه پاک کردن
نتیجه
- 41 - مراحل بعدی
دوره های مرتبط
- دوره آموزشی یادگیری جامع Swift 6
- دوره آموزشی راهنمای کامل SwiftUI
- دوره آموزشی برنامه نویسی برای غیر برنامه نویسان: iOS 17 و Swift 5
- دوره آموزشی یادگیری جامع SwiftData
- دوره آموزشی یادگیری جامع توسعه iOS 17
- دوره آموزشی ساخت اولین برنامه iOS 17
- دوره آموزشی ساخت اپلیکیشن SwiftUI Playgrounds
- دوره آموزشی برنامه نویسی برای غیر برنامه نویسان: iOS 16 و Swift 5